▎ 摘  要

NOVELTY - Low-temperature and fast preparation of oligomeric graphene with large interlayer distance, comprises (i) preparing the graphene oxide (GO) dispersion by Hummers method as precursor, drying until the moisture content is 20-45% to obtain GO powder, and (ii) placing the GO powder in a tubular furnace, and heating to a certain temperature under the protection atmosphere to generate micro-explosion peeling. USE - The oligomeric graphene is useful in cathode material for potassium ion battery (claimed). ADVANTAGE - The method has excellent potassium storage performance, high structural stability, and buffering of volume expansion during electrochemical reactions. DETAILED DESCRIPTION - INDEPENDENT CLAIMS are also included for: Preparing highly reduced oligomeric graphene with large interlayer distance; and Cathode electrode material for a potassium ion battery.
